Detailed specifications
General parameters such as number of shaders, GPU core base clock and boost clock speeds, manufacturing process, texturing and calculation speed. Note that power consumption of some graphics cards can well exceed their nominal TDP, especially when overclocked.
| Pipelines / CUDA cores | 32 | 2048 |
| Core clock speed | 120 MHz | 900 MHz |
| Boost clock speed | no data | 2050 MHz |
| Number of transistors | 314 million | 21,700 million |
| Manufacturing process technology | 55 nm | 6 nm |
| Power consumption (TDP) | 23 Watt | 60 Watt |
| Texture fill rate | 8.000 | 262.4 |
| Floating-point processing power | 0.08 TFLOPS | 8.397 TFLOPS |
| ROPs | 8 | 64 |
| TMUs | 16 | 128 |
| Tensor Cores | no data | 256 |
| Ray Tracing Cores | no data | 16 |
| L1 Cache | no data | 3 MB |
| L2 Cache | 32 KB | 8 MB |

VRAM capacity and type
Parameters of VRAM installed: its type, size, bus, clock and resulting bandwidth. Integrated GPUs have no dedicated video RAM and use a shared part of system RAM.
| Memory type | GDDR3 | GDDR6 |
| Maximum RAM amount | 512 MB | 8 GB |
| Memory bus width | 128 Bit | 128 Bit |
| Memory clock speed | 800 MHz | 1750 MHz |
| Memory bandwidth | 25.6 GB/s | 224.0 GB/s |
| Shared memory | - | - |
| Resizable BAR | - | + |
